What to Do If a Cat Has Otitis Media and Inner Ear Infection?

Himalayan Cat

 Otitis media can occur due to worsening otitis externa or bacterial bloodstream infection causing inflammation of the middle ear; if it leads to inner ear infection, it will affect hearing and balance, causing abnormal movements with the head tilted toward the infected side. Immediate veterinary treatment is required, or permanent hearing damage may occur. (Source:PetsZone)
